- Chemistry: Essential for understanding the composition of substances and analyzing materials.
- Biology: Crucial for DNA analysis, studying biological samples, and understanding the human body.
- Criminal Justice: Provides a framework for understanding laws, procedures, and the legal system.
- Forensic Science: Core courses that cover topics like crime scene investigation, evidence collection, and forensic analysis techniques.
- Mathematics and Statistics: Necessary for analyzing data and interpreting results.
- Securing the scene: Protecting the area from contamination and ensuring evidence is preserved.
- Photography and sketching: Documenting the scene as it is found.
- Evidence collection: Properly collecting, packaging, and labeling evidence to maintain its integrity.
- Chain of custody: Maintaining a detailed record of who has handled the evidence at all times.
- Drugs and controlled substances: Identifying and quantifying illegal substances.
- Trace evidence: Analyzing small particles like fibers, paint chips, and glass fragments.
- Arson investigation: Determining the cause and origin of fires.
- Toxicology: Detecting and identifying poisons and toxins in biological samples.
- DNA extraction and analysis: Isolating DNA from samples and creating DNA profiles.
- Serology: Analyzing blood and other bodily fluids.
- Forensic entomology: Using insects to estimate the time of death.
- Forensic anthropology: Analyzing skeletal remains to identify individuals and determine the cause of death.
- Constitutional law: Learning about the rights of the accused and the limitations of law enforcement.
- Rules of evidence: Understanding what evidence is admissible in court and how it can be presented.
- Courtroom testimony: Learning how to effectively communicate scientific findings in a courtroom setting.
- Different fingerprint patterns: Arches, loops, and whorls.
- Latent print development: Techniques for visualizing fingerprints on various surfaces.
- Fingerprint comparison: Matching fingerprints to identify individuals.
- Firearm identification: Determining the type of firearm used in a crime.
- Bullet trajectory analysis: Reconstructing the path of a bullet.
- Gunshot residue analysis: Detecting and analyzing gunshot residue on clothing and other surfaces.
- Analytical Skills: Forensics is all about analyzing data and drawing conclusions. You'll learn how to think critically and solve problems using scientific methods.
- Attention to Detail: In forensics, even the smallest details can be crucial. You'll develop a keen eye for detail and learn how to meticulously document your findings.
- Communication Skills: Being able to communicate your findings clearly and effectively is essential. You'll learn how to write reports, present evidence in court, and explain complex scientific concepts to non-scientists.
- Problem-Solving Skills: Forensics is often about solving puzzles. You'll learn how to approach problems systematically, gather information, and develop creative solutions.
- Technical Skills: You'll gain hands-on experience with a variety of laboratory equipment and techniques, from DNA sequencing to microscopy.
- Crime Scene Investigator: As a crime scene investigator, you'll be responsible for documenting and collecting evidence at crime scenes. This can involve anything from photographing the scene to collecting fingerprints to packaging evidence for laboratory analysis.
- Forensic Science Technician: Forensic science technicians work in laboratories, analyzing evidence and preparing reports. They may specialize in a particular area, such as DNA analysis, toxicology, or ballistics.
- Laboratory Analyst: Laboratory analysts perform a variety of tests on evidence, such as blood samples, drugs, and other materials. They use sophisticated equipment and techniques to identify and quantify substances.
- Medical Examiner Investigator: Medical examiner investigators assist medical examiners in investigating deaths. They may visit crime scenes, interview witnesses, and gather medical records.
- Quality Assurance: You can also work in quality assurance in forensic labs, ensuring that they meet standards. This involves auditing procedures, reviewing data, and implementing corrective actions.
- Research and Development: A forensics degree can also lead to research and development roles, where you'll be involved in developing new forensic techniques and technologies.
- Are you passionate about science and investigation? If you love science and enjoy solving puzzles, forensics might be a good fit.
- Are you detail-oriented and meticulous? Forensics requires a high degree of accuracy and attention to detail.
- Are you able to handle sensitive and disturbing content? Working in forensics can expose you to graphic crime scenes and disturbing evidence.
- Are you comfortable working in a laboratory setting? Many forensics jobs involve spending a lot of time in a laboratory.
- Are you able to communicate effectively? Being able to communicate your findings clearly and concisely is essential.
- Master's Degree: A master's degree in forensic science or a related field can provide you with more advanced knowledge and skills, as well as open doors to more specialized job roles.
- Doctoral Degree: If you're interested in research or teaching, a doctoral degree might be the right choice for you. A PhD can lead to careers in academia or research institutions.
- Certifications: There are a variety of professional certifications available in forensic science, such as those offered by the American Board of Criminalistics (ABC). These certifications can demonstrate your expertise and enhance your career prospects.
- Digital Forensics: Analyzing digital devices and data to uncover evidence of cybercrime.
- Forensic Psychology: Applying psychological principles to the legal system.
- Forensic Engineering: Investigating accidents and failures to determine their cause.

What Exactly is a Forensics Bachelor's Degree?
Okay, let's start with the basics. A forensics bachelor's degree is an undergraduate program designed to give you a strong foundation in the scientific principles and techniques used to analyze evidence in criminal investigations. Forget what you see on TV – it's not all dramatic CSI moments! While those shows can be entertaining, the reality is a lot more detailed and methodical.
Typically, the curriculum will include courses in:
Think of it as a blend of hard science and legal knowledge, all geared towards solving crimes and providing evidence in court. A strong foundation in these areas is crucial for anyone looking to succeed in the field.
